#include <settings/grid_settings.h>
#include <nlohmann/json.hpp>
#include <wx/translation.h>
#include <core/json_serializers.h>
#include <units_provider.h>
wxString GRID::MessageText( EDA_IU_SCALE aScale, EDA_UNITS aUnits, bool aDisplayUnits ) const
{
EDA_DATA_TYPE type = EDA_DATA_TYPE::DISTANCE;
wxString xStr = EDA_UNIT_UTILS::UI::MessageTextFromValue(
aScale, aUnits,
EDA_UNIT_UTILS::UI::DoubleValueFromString( aScale, EDA_UNITS::MILLIMETRES, x, type ),
aDisplayUnits );
wxString yStr = EDA_UNIT_UTILS::UI::MessageTextFromValue(
aScale, aUnits,
EDA_UNIT_UTILS::UI::DoubleValueFromString( aScale, EDA_UNITS::MILLIMETRES, y, type ),
aDisplayUnits );
if( xStr == yStr )
return xStr;
return wxString::Format( wxS( "%s x %s" ), xStr, yStr );
}
wxString GRID::UserUnitsMessageText( UNITS_PROVIDER* aProvider, bool aDisplayUnits ) const
{
return MessageText( aProvider->GetIuScale(), aProvider->GetUserUnits(), aDisplayUnits );
}
VECTOR2D GRID::ToDouble( EDA_IU_SCALE aScale ) const
{
return VECTOR2D{
EDA_UNIT_UTILS::UI::DoubleValueFromString( aScale, EDA_UNITS::MILLIMETRES, x ),
EDA_UNIT_UTILS::UI::DoubleValueFromString( aScale, EDA_UNITS::MILLIMETRES, y ),
};
}
bool GRID::operator==( const GRID& aOther ) const
{
return x == aOther.x && y == aOther.y && name == aOther.name;
}
bool operator!=( const GRID& lhs, const GRID& rhs )
{
return !( lhs == rhs );
}
bool operator<( const GRID& lhs, const GRID& rhs )
{
return lhs.name < rhs.name;
}
void to_json( nlohmann::json& j, const GRID& g )
{
j = nlohmann::json{
{ "name", g.name },
{ "x", g.x },
{ "y", g.y },
};
}
void from_json( const nlohmann::json& j, GRID& g )
{
j.at( "name" ).get_to( g.name );
j.at( "x" ).get_to( g.x );
j.at( "y" ).get_to( g.y );
}
